Role of Rubber Hoses in the Oil and Gas Industry

1. Activities Related to Drilling

Drilling mud is transferred between pumps and the drill string by robust rotary and vibrator hoses, which keep rigs operating. To ensure safe and efficient drilling, this circulation keeps the equipment cool, keeps the pressure constant, and clears the boreholes of rock shavings.

2. Fuel and Oil Transfer

Moving lubricants, refined fuels, and crude oil between trucks, pipelines, tanks, and ships requires rubber hoses. Even in challenging offshore conditions, operators can manage transfers with ease and safety thanks to their strength and adaptability.

3. Hydraulic and Pneumatic Systems

High-pressure rubber hoses move hydraulic fluids or compressed air to power rig components, valves, and pneumatic tools. They make it easier for personnel to operate machinery and maintain precision during vital procedures.

4. Managing Chemicals

Rubber hoses transport acids, solvents, and other production chemicals that are utilized in cleaning or treating wells. As they are resistant to abrasion and corrosion, they are ideal to safely handle aggressive substances.

5. Utility and Water Supply

Rubber hoses can help transport water that can be used for firefighting, equipment washing, cooling systems, and other rig and refinery maintenance operations. Due to their lightweight design, they can be used in harsh offshore environments, as they can be handled easily.

6. Offshore and Marine Use

Rubber hoses are used to transfer oil, gas, and related products between floating equipment, loading arms, and storage units on platforms and ships. They offer the adaptability required in dynamic marine environments.

7. Waste and Slurry Handling

These hoses can be used for drilling and refining to transport sludge, slurry, and other waste byproducts. Rubber hoses have resilience towards harsh conditions and wear, preventing leaks and contamination.
